BEIJING (AP) When it was all over, Hugh McCutcheon didn't have to tell his wife that his U.S. men's volleyball team had beaten the odds - and overcome tragedy - to win the Olympic gold medal.
"She said it first," the coach recalled. "She said, 'You won, you won, you won!' Nothing else to say there, just listening to each other smile on the phone."
The men's team claimed the gold with a 3-1 victory over defending champion Brazil on Sunday. The victory capped a stunning run by the U.S. team over the two weeks after Elisabeth McCutcheon's father was stabbed to death in Beijing.
